Sleep apnea is a type of sleep disorder which is characterized by reduced breathing during sleep, with the individual experiencing shallow breaths. Sometimes, there can also be a cessation of breathing during sleep. There are different types of sleep apnea which include the obstructive apnea, central apnea, and a mixture of both. Sleep apnea is a disorder that is experienced by a lot of people and it is important to know that it can occur at any age. At the clinic, a sleep specialist will be happy to render his professional services in the process of treating your sleep disorder.  Sleep apnea is mostly caused by the collapse of the airway passages during sleep. There is relaxation of the muscles which are located in the throat which obstructs the passage of air.

Sleep apnea has a variety of consequences which include high blood pressure, heart disease, poor sleep quality which would lead to fatigue during the daytime, and headaches. Because most people who have sleep apnea do not know that they have sleep apnea, sleep apnea is oftentimes difficult to discover. Symptoms of Sleep Apnea

Sleep apnea is associated with a variety of symptoms which include

  • Insomnia
  • Irritability
  • Headache
  • Difficulty in concentrating
  • Fatigue during the day
  • Sleepiness during the day.
  • Gasping for air
  • Snoring
  • Poor attention

Tests for Sleep Apnea

Tests for sleep apnea are carried out by a sleep specialist who carries out various tests on the individual in order to ascertain the precise cause of the sleep apnea and prescribe the best available treatment.

Sleep apnea tests include home sleep tests and nocturnal polysomnography. A typical polysomnography test includes electroencephalography (EEG), electromyogram(EMG), electrooculogram(EOG), measurement of airflow through the oral cavity and nasal cavity, measurement of the movement of the chest cavity and abdominal cavity,  measurement of the oxygen levels of the blood, an audio recording of how high the individual’s snoring is and a video recording of the individual during the period of the test.
